花魁直播高品质美女在线视频互动社区 - 花魁直播官方版

 歡迎來到素材無憂網(wǎng),按 + 收藏我們
登錄 注冊 退出 找回密碼

discuz大流量站點推薦使用穩(wěn)定性更好的APC加速緩存

時間: 2019-05-23 08:07 閱讀: 作者:素材無憂網(wǎng)

    APC 和 eAccelerator 都是不錯的PHP加速緩存,但是為什么在這里要推薦使用 APC 而不是 eAccelerator 呢?   1,根據(jù)我們對幾個大站點的測試,雖然 eAccelerator 在低負(fù)載下,性能要比 APC 好點,但是在大流量長期運(yùn)行的情況下,APC 要比 eAccelerator 要更為穩(wěn)定。我們推薦出現(xiàn)了 PHP 突然假死,無故出現(xiàn) 502 報錯的站點,改用 APC 。   2,Discuz! X2 開始支持用 APC 作為論壇緩存,經(jīng)過大量站點的使用情況來看,APC的穩(wěn)定性很好,不會出現(xiàn)一些靈異情況。   3,APC 的發(fā)展迅速,自從 FACEBOOK 加入對 APC 的更新后,得到了很大發(fā)展,而 eAccelerator 新版本穩(wěn)定性不佳,功能和代碼都被刪除了不少。   4,APC 對 PHP5.3 版本支持良好。   APC的安裝很簡單   1,下載APC  wget http://pecl.php.net/get/APC-3.1.9.tgz 復(fù)制代碼 2,解壓和編譯 tar zxvf APC-3.1.9.tgz cd APC-3.1.9 /usr/local/php5/bin/phpize ./configure --enable-apc --enable-mmap --enable-apc-spinlocks --disable-apc-pthreadmutex --with-php-config=/usr/local/php5/bin/php-config make make install make clean 復(fù)制代碼 3,編輯php.ini   找到 extension_dir ,把值改為/usr/local/php5/lib/php/extensions/no-debug-non-zts-20060613/ 然后在下面加入 extension=apc.so apc.enabled = 1 apc.shm_size = 64M apc.stat = 1 復(fù)制代碼其中apc.shm_size設(shè)置的是內(nèi)存大小,一般用64M即可,小內(nèi)存的可以改為32M。 apc.stat設(shè)置成0的話,性能會更好一點,但是設(shè)置成0后,修改了PHP文件后必須得重啟下PHP才能馬上更新內(nèi)容。對于平時修改比較多的站點來說,還是設(shè)置成1比較好。   4,重啟PHP即可生效。

版權(quán)聲明: 本站資源均來自互聯(lián)網(wǎng)或會員發(fā)布,如果侵犯了您的權(quán)益請與我們聯(lián)系,我們將在24小時內(nèi)刪除!謝謝!

轉(zhuǎn)載請注明: discuz大流量站點推薦使用穩(wěn)定性更好的APC加速緩存

標(biāo)簽:  
相關(guān)文章
模板推薦